When people search for information about health and safety risks caused by small animals in commercial facilities, they are often concerned about how these creatures can impact the safety of employees, visitors, and the integrity of their property. Small animals such as rodents, squirrels, or bats can carry diseases that pose direct health threats through bites, droppings, or contaminated surfaces. Additionally, their presence may lead to contamination of food supplies or stored goods, creating potential hazards for food safety and sanitation. Understanding these risks helps facility managers and property owners recognize the importance of prompt and effective removal to maintain a safe environment for everyone involved.

This topic is closely related to various operational and safety plans within commercial settings. For example, facilities that handle food products, pharmaceuticals, or sensitive equipment must prioritize pest prevention and control measures to ensure compliance with health standards. Small animals can cause structural damage by gnawing on wiring, insulation, or building materials, which might increase the risk of fire or equipment failure. Moreover, the presence of these animals often indicates gaps or vulnerabilities in building maintenance, prompting the need for integrated pest management strategies. Addressing these issues proactively with the help of local service providers can prevent more serious health and safety problems from developing over time.

The types of properties most commonly affected by small animals include warehouses, manufacturing plants, retail stores, restaurants, and office complexes. Warehouses storing food or goods are especially vulnerable, as small animals can easily access stored items and spread contamination. Food processing facilities must be vigilant about pest intrusion to prevent health violations and product recalls. Commercial buildings with accessible attics, basements, or roof spaces are also at risk, as these areas often serve as nesting sites for rodents and bats. Small animals such as rodents, birds, and insects can pose significant health and safety risks in commercial facilities. Their presence often leads to contamination of food storage areas, equipment, and surfaces with droppings, urine, and nesting materials, which can spread bacteria, viruses, and parasites. Additionally, small animals may cause structural damage by gnawing on wiring, insulation, and building materials, increasing the risk of electrical fires or costly repairs.
